OSOGBO — The Osun State Government has issued a scathing warning to the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) and the Office of the Accountant General of the Federation (AGF), accusing both federal agencies of attempting to illegally divert local government allocations to private accounts allegedly linked to political loyalists of the former administration.

In an official statement released by the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s, Hon. Dosu Babatunde, the state alleged a “conspiracy” aimed at sabotaging ongoing legal proceedings at the Supreme Court concerning local government administration in Osun.

According to Babatunde, “We have credible information indicating that plans have been finalized by the CBN and AGF to pay Osun LG funds into private accounts of impostors—individuals not recognized by law or the local government accounting structure of the state.”

He revealed that the Osun Auditor General for Local Governments had earlier communicated formally with the CBN, introducing the legally appointed accounting officers of the state’s 30 LGAs, including the Heads of Local Government Administrations (HLAs) and Directors of Finance. Despite this, the CBN Osogbo branch allegedly rejected the list, raising fears that the funds were about to be misdirected.

Babatunde described the alleged move as a “blatant violation of Nigeria’s public finance laws”, and warned that any transfer of public funds to private individuals would not be recognized as legitimate by the Osun State Government.

“This unconstitutional action will have grave consequences. The Osun State Government will not hesitate to take all lawful steps to ensure accountability and protect the public interest,” the Commissioner stated.

He further called on President Bola Ahmed Tinubu and the Minister of Finance to urgently intervene, expressing confidence that the plot was being orchestrated without their knowledge or approval.

“This is a clear attempt to subvert the rule of law and compromise public finance systems. Mr. President must act to stop this travesty,” Babatunde appealed.

This development comes in the wake of lingering tensions between the Osun State Government and some officials allegedly aligned with the former administration of Governor Gboyega Oyetola. The dispute over control and legitimacy at the local government level is already a subject of litigation before the Supreme Court of Nigeria.

As of press time, neither the CBN nor the AGF’s office has issued an official response to the allegations.
